Retired policeman Luke Fitzwilliam meets one of its residents on a train. She tells him that someone is killing off the residents one by one and she is on her way to tell Scotland Yard about it. However before she can do so she is killed by a hit and run driver.
A stay in the village provides Luke with a bewildering cast of suspects but with the help of Superintendent Battle the killer is finally unmasked.

Agatha Christie is the most popular mystery writer if all time. With over two billion books sold, her genius for detective fiction is unparalleled. She is truly the one and only Queen of Crime. In a writing career that spanned more than half a century, Agatha Christie wrote 79 novels and short story collections. She died on 12 January 1976. Sean Barrett's many television credits include Z Cars, Minder , Brush Strokes and Father Ted. He has appeared in the West End with Noel Coward and is a member of the BBC Radio Drama Company. His TV documentary narrations include The People's Century and he is an experienced audio book reader.
